Low Carb Keto Pizza Casserole

Jump to Recipe

This Low Carb Keto Pizza Casserole is of my favorites on my Low carb day. We love pizza night at our house. This is my way of getting to enjoy pizza while still eating healthy. Even my kids like it. It’s even Paleo, FWTFL friendly (omit cheese).

Low-Carb Keto Pizza Casserole

The best part about this recipe is you can add any of your favorite toppings. I used mushrooms, onions, green peppers, Italian sausage, turkey pepperoni, and fresh mozzarella. I highly recommend using fresh mozzarella. The large mozzarella slices really help with keeping the pizza easy to serve since there isn’t any crust in this recipe.

Ingredients
  

  • 1/2 Tbsp. avacado oil or olive oil
  • 1 lb. Italian sausage
  • 1/2 cup diced sweet onion
  • Pizza Sauce no sugar added
  • 1/2 tsp. Oregano seasoning
  • Dash of sea salt and fresh ground pepper
  • 1/3 cup diced green pepper
  • 1 cup fresh diced mushrooms
  • 20 Turkey Pepperoni make 4 rows
  • 8 oz. Fresh Mozzarella sliced. (make 3 rows)

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• In a large skillet add Avocado oil on medium heat.
  • Add sausage and onion and cook until brown. Drain and use a paper towel to wipe out skillet.
  • Return cooked sausage and onion mixture to skillet and add pizza sauce salt, pepper, and oregano. Mix well.
  • Spray 13x9" casserole dish with non-stick spray and add sausage mix.
  • Dice green pepper and mushrooms and add to casserole dish.
  • Lay 4 rows of Turkey Pepperoni.
  • Top with 3 rows of the fresh mozzarella slices.
  • Bake for 15-20 minutes.
  • Remove from oven and let sit for 10 minutes to set up.
